art |
things that are made by humans and that people think have beauty or deep meaning. Music, films, written works, and paintings are examples of art. |
beach |
the land at the edge of a lake, ocean, or other body of water. A beach is often formed of sand or small stones. |
bush |
a low plant like a small tree. |
cannon |
a large gun that is set on wheels or some other base. Cannons fire heavy shells. |
clothes |
things that you wear to cover the body. |
fat |
having too much weight. |
hole |
an open or hollow place in something. |
ice |
frozen, solid water. |
land |
the solid part of the earth's surface. |
mower |
a machine with blades for cutting grass or other plants. |
peaceful |
quiet; calm. |
phone |
a short form of telephone. |
post1 |
a piece of wood, metal, or other material placed upright in the ground to mark or support something. |
trick |
to deceive someone. |
worried |
feeling trouble or anxiety about something that might happen. |
